About methyl N-[[3,5-dibromo-2-[[1-(3-chloro-2-pyridinyl)-5-methylsulfanylpyrrole-2-carbonyl]amino]benzoyl]amino]carbamate

methyl N-[[3,5-dibromo-2-[[1-(3-chloro-2-pyridinyl)-5-methylsulfanylpyrrole-2-carbonyl]amino]benzoyl]amino]carbamate (PubChem CID 59286872) has the molecular formula C20H16Br2ClN5O4S and a molecular weight of 617.71 g/mol. Its IUPAC name is methyl N-[[3,5-dibromo-2-[[1-(3-chloro-2-pyridinyl)-5-methylsulfanylpyrrole-2-carbonyl]amino]benzoyl]amino]carbamate.
